At the Windham Public Safety Building on Saturday, Windham officials and volunteers brainstormed how best to control growth in town and bring it in line with Windham’s ten-year Comprehensive Master Plan. Left to right, Michael Shaughnessy, Will Plumley, Elizabeth Wisecup, Elaine Pollock, John Mackinnon, Bob Muir, Roger Timmons, Blaine Rich, Michael Manning, Jim Lauzier, Tony Plante and Keith Williams (seated). The group – comprised of town councilors, staff and planning volunteers – spent the day discussing a process to meet goals set out by the Comp Plan, all the while keeping in mind the rights of developers and impact of growth on the environment and community at large. The group will meet again at 7 p.m. on Thursday, Apr. 27 at Windham Town Offices. Courtesy photo
